Arthur and Esther were my grandparents. Arthur is a well known Buffalo, NY artist, though only known by the local art community for his "industrial" period.  Esther was not known as an artist, she was known as a gardener and an award winning quilter. For the past few years I have been introducing her artwork to the local art community, and donated 2 of her pieces to the Birchfield Penney Art Center. I have been telling people that my grandfather's real passion was landscapes and have been able to share his landscapes with many people.
Arthur H Lindberg
In addition to my grandfather's industrial period, he was an amazing portrait artist. This is
a portrait he did of me when I was six years old, it hangs in my dining room. He made his own pastels, see the box to the right of him in the photo?  That box contained an amazing range of colors. He did portaits of our family and many people in Buffalo.

He also created what we called "scrolls". They were awards or recogntion pieces awarded to different people for various reasons. He was especially proud of the scroll he did that was presented to Queen Elizabeth from the City of Buffalo, see below. And I also found a copy of one given to Richard Nixon

He was also known for his restorations, Charles Penney told me my grandfather used to do restorations for him, I hadn't known that previously. Below are some before and after pictures my grandfather saved.

I remember seeing pieces that he was working on in the basement of my grandparents home. I didn't appreciate exactly what he was doing at that point.

He also did Murals, this was a surprise to me. I assume these are long gone, painted over. The first one was at St, John Marons in Amherst, the second was at Shields & Co., in Buffalo.

Esther Perry Barlow Lindberg
My grandmother was born in 1901 in Worchester, Mass. and died in 1996, just short of her 95th birthday. She was an amazing gardener, you can see where I got my love of gardening from, and an award winning quilter.

She and my grandfather traveled to Vermont starting in 1955, so my grandfather could paint. She got tired of watching him paint and decided to try herself. With my grandfather as her teacher, she painted many wonderful paintings along side of my grandfather. Here are a few examples:
